Emerging Communication Technologies for Latin America Revealed


With competition slowly rising in Latin America, telecom service providers are adopting new technologies to differentiate their products and services. These emerging communication technologies and cloud solutions are being demonstrated this week at Futurecom, a telecommunications, IT and Internet event in Latin America.

One such company to showcase its communications products is cloud communications provider GENBAND. The company intends to demonstrate its IP Transformation, Unified Communications (UC), WebRTC, Over-the-Top (OTT) service, and network security solutions at the Futurecom Conference & Exhibition in Rio De Janeiro, Brazil.

In a statement, GENBAND’s chief marketing officer Brad Bush said, “Latin America is one of the most dynamic growth markets in the communications industry, so we are pleased to showcase our market-leading solutions at the most influential conference in the region.” He further added, “Our all-IP-based portfolio provides solutions to help carriers bring innovative technology and services to their customers and capitalize on the growth opportunities in the region.”

GENBAND said that it’s leading-edge IP transformation and IMS solutions offer cost-effective approach to moving to an all-IP infrastructure. While the company’s advanced UC solutions enable operators to offer their customers a completely connected user experience, whether working at home, in the office or anywhere in the world.

Similarly, GENBAND’s SPiDR WebRTC Gateway offers a comprehensive and seamless bridge between the traditional VoIP networks and the Internet to allow operators to quickly develop and deploy innovative applications that enhance customer satisfaction. Recently, the SPiDR WebRTC Gateway was honored for its superior performance as a recipient of Broadband Technology Report’s (BTR) 2013 Diamond Broadband Technology Review award. The award recognizes top products and solutions available to the cable industry as determined by a distinguished panel of independent consulting engineers.

The judges indicated that the award was given to SPiDR’s for its openness and appeal to the web development masses. In addition, the judges anticipate unexpected apps will pop up, among which will be few gems that make this “well worth pursuing.”

Now in its ninth year, the BTR Diamond Technology Reviews is a renowned industry program that was developed to recognize some of the top products and solutions available to the cable industry as determined by a distinguished panel of cable telecommunications engineering experts.
